Best time to go to Torrance

The best time to visit Torrance can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Torrance fal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Torrance falls in January,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is very c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January16.7°F (-8.5°C)Light RainVery C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
February17.8°F (-7.9°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ageAverage
March27.5°F (-2.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April39.4°F (4.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
May53.6°F (12.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June61.7°F (16.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July67.5°F (19.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August66.0°F (18.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
September59.2°F (15.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
October47.5°F (8.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November35.4°F (1.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
December25.3°F (-3.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age

What's the seasonal weather like in Torrance?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 64°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 22°F. Average annual precipitation for Torrance is 48 inches.
